Akhilesh Yadav Hails Azam Khan’s Release, Slams BJP Over ‘Fake Cases’

New Delhi: Samajwadi Party (SP) president Akhilesh Yadav on Tuesday welcomed the release of senior party leader Azam Khan from Sitapur jail, calling it a “matter of relief and joy” not only for Khan’s family but for all who believe in justice. He also accused the BJP of framing the veteran leader in false cases for political vendetta.

Akhilesh Yadav Thanks Court, Attacks BJP

In a post on X, the former Uttar Pradesh chief minister said, “The release of the honorable Azam Khan ji is a matter of relief and joy not only for him and his family and all of us, but also for all those people who have faith in justice. Heartfelt thanks to the court for upholding faith in justice.” He alleged that those who filed “fake cases” against Khan have now realized that “every lie and every conspiracy has an expiry date.” Speaking to reporters, Yadav reiterated that no fresh false cases should be filed by the BJP government and vowed that a future SP government would withdraw all politically motivated cases against Khan.

Shivpal Yadav Defends Khan, Rejects BSP Speculation

SP leader Shivpal Singh Yadav, who came to receive Azam Khan, also accused the Yogi Adityanath-led government of framing him. “Azam Khan was framed by the government in false cases. However, the court has granted him bail and has provided relief. The Samajwadi Party stands beside him,” he said. Shivpal dismissed speculation of Khan joining the Bahujan Samaj Party (BSP), insisting the SP stands united with him.

Azam Khan’s Return After 23 Months

Azam Khan, a ten-time MLA from Rampur and former UP minister, was released after nearly 23 months in custody in connection with the Quality Bar land encroachment case and other charges. Police records list 111 criminal cases against him, but his lawyer claims many were politically motivated, with several withdrawn or pending trial. Large crowds of supporters, including his son Adeeb, gathered outside Sitapur jail to welcome him, prompting heavy security and drone surveillance.
